“We’re excited to welcome Bill to the board of directors. He is an impressive executive with a diverse background in finance, logistics, operational efficiencies and service differentiation, all of which are key to our strategy,” Jim Fish, president and CEO of Waste Management, says. “His valuable experience executing a customer-focused strategy, driving organic revenue growth and improving free cash flow will be great assets to our existing board and the company, and we’re looking forward to his contributions.”
